ROSSA DOP 750ml
Rossa PDO* Umbria Colli Assisi Spoleto Extra Virgin Olive Oil is a blend of different variety of olives, especially moraiolo (no less than 60%), frantoio, leccino and others, that grow on the rocky terrains between the medieval towns of Assisi and Spoleto villages of Assisi and Spoleto, in Umbria.
